'The Facts Do Not Matter': The Court Let States Ban Trans Kids From Sports Without Requiring Any Evidence
Justice Sotomayor read her dissent aloud from the bench on June 30, 2026 — a step justices reserve for cases where they want the disagreement on the public record, not just in print. Her summary of what the majority had just done: “the facts do not matter, even though the consequences are serious.” She was describing a ruling that let states ban transgender girls from school sports teams without ever resolving the central factual dispute the case turned on. ...
